Self-intersection of the relative dualizing sheaf on modular curves X(N)

Abstract
Let be a composite, odd, and square-free integer and let be the principal congruence subgroup of level . Let be the modular curve of genus associated to . In this article, we study the Arakelov invariant , with denoting the self-intersection of the relative dualizing sheaf for the minimal regular model of , equipped with the Arakelov metric, and is the Euler's phi function. Our main result is the asymptotics , as the level tends to infinity.
